Windows系统膨胀:原因、影响及应对策略161


Windows操作系统自诞生以来,经历了数十年的发展,其功能日益强大,但随之而来的是系统文件和安装程序的体积持续膨胀。这种“Windows系统越来越大”的现象,引发了用户和业内人士的广泛关注。本文将从操作系统的角度,深入探讨Windows系统膨胀的原因、对用户和系统的影响以及一些可能的应对策略。

一、Windows系统膨胀的原因:

Windows系统体积的膨胀并非偶然,而是多种因素综合作用的结果:

1. 功能增加和特性增强: 这是最主要的原因。每一个新版本的Windows都引入了新的功能、特性和改进,例如新的图形界面元素、更强大的安全机制、更丰富的多媒体支持、更完善的网络功能等等。这些功能的实现需要额外的代码、驱动程序、库文件和资源,直接导致系统文件数量和大小的增加。例如,Windows 10引入的Windows Hello面部识别、Cortana语音助手等功能,都增加了系统占用的存储空间。

2. 兼容性需求:为了保证与旧版应用程序和硬件的兼容性,微软需要在新的操作系统中保留对旧技术的支持。这部分代码虽然可能不再被广泛使用,但却不能轻易移除,因为移除可能导致某些应用程序或硬件无法正常工作,从而引发兼容性问题。这种向后兼容性的需求,也使得系统文件体积不断膨胀。

3. 安全更新和补丁: 随着网络安全威胁的日益严峻,微软需要不断发布安全更新和补丁来修复漏洞和提升安全性。这些更新和补丁通常包含大量的代码,用于解决特定的安全问题,也会增加系统文件的大小。

4. 预装软件和应用: 在很多预装Windows系统的电脑中,厂商会预装一些额外的软件和应用,这些软件会占用额外的磁盘空间。虽然这些软件并非Windows操作系统本身的一部分,但它们的存在也间接增加了系统所占用的总空间。

5. 驱动程序和硬件支持: 现代计算机硬件种类繁多,Windows需要提供相应的驱动程序来支持这些硬件设备。随着新硬件的不断涌现,需要不断更新和添加驱动程序,这也会增加系统文件的大小。

6. 多语言支持: 为了支持全球多语言用户,Windows操作系统需要包含多种语言的资源文件。这些资源文件占据了相当大的存储空间。

二、Windows系统膨胀的影响:

Windows系统体积的膨胀对用户和系统都带来了一定的负面影响:

1. 存储空间占用增加: 最直接的影响就是占用更多的硬盘空间。对于一些存储空间有限的设备,例如固态硬盘,这可能会导致存储空间不足,影响其他应用程序的安装和运行。

2. 系统启动时间延长: 更大的系统文件意味着更长的系统启动时间。启动时间过长会影响用户体验,降低工作效率。

3. 系统运行速度下降: 系统文件过多过大,会增加系统资源的消耗,例如内存和CPU,从而导致系统运行速度下降。

4. 系统维护成本增加: 更大的系统意味着更多的文件需要维护和更新,这会增加系统的维护成本。

5. 更新下载时间延长: 系统更新文件体积增加,也会导致更新下载时间延长。

三、应对Windows系统膨胀的策略:

针对Windows系统膨胀的问题,用户可以采取一些策略来减轻其影响:

1. 卸载不必要的应用程序: 卸载一些不常用的预装软件或应用程序,可以释放大量的磁盘空间。

2. 清理临时文件和缓存: 定期清理系统临时文件、缓存文件和垃圾文件,可以释放部分磁盘空间并提高系统运行速度。

3. 使用系统清理工具: 一些专业的系统清理工具可以帮助用户更有效地清理系统垃圾文件和优化系统性能。

4. 升级硬件: 如果存储空间不足,可以考虑升级到更大的硬盘或固态硬盘。

5. 选择精简版Windows: 对于一些对系统功能要求不高的用户,可以选择一些精简版的Windows系统,这些系统通常体积较小,运行速度更快。

6. 谨慎安装软件: 安装软件时,注意选择只安装必要的组件,避免安装多余的软件或插件。

总而言之,Windows系统体积的膨胀是一个复杂的问题,它涉及到操作系统的功能、兼容性、安全性和用户需求等多方面因素。虽然无法完全避免系统体积的增长,但通过采取一些合理的策略,用户可以有效地减轻其负面影响,保持系统的良好运行状态。

2025-05-11


上一篇:Android系统深度解析:架构、核心组件及应用生态

下一篇:华为鸿蒙系统最低硬件要求及系统架构适配性分析